- himanshumeenaNov 16, 2022 · 3 years agoAs an expert in the cryptocurrency industry, I can confirm that pump and dump schemes are indeed illegal in most jurisdictions. These schemes are considered market manipulation and are subject to penalties and legal consequences. Regulatory bodies, such as the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) in the United States, actively monitor and investigate pump and dump activities to protect investors. It's important to stay informed about the regulations in your country and report any suspicious activities to the appropriate authorities.
